Understanding uPVC Doors with Windows: The Composite Solution for Modern Homes

Recently, the construction and remodeling industry has progressively preferred uPVC (unplasticized polyvinyl chloride) doors with windows as a contemporary service for domestic and commercial homes. Providing an excellent blend of toughness, energy effectiveness, and aesthetic appeal, these composite door systems have acquired tremendous appeal among house owners and contractors alike. This post explores the advantages, features, and various options offered in uPVC doors with windows, along with regularly asked questions concerning their installation and maintenance.

What are uPVC Doors?

uPVC is a high-performance material thoroughly utilized in the building and construction of doors and windows. Unlike conventional PVC, uPVC is rigid and does not sag, making it especially suitable for frames, particularly in doors with large glass panels. The mix of uPVC and windows offers a flexible solution that meets the demands of modern visual appeals and performance.

Key Features of uPVC Doors with Windows

Here are the main qualities that make uPVC doors with windows a preferred option:

  • Durability and Longevity: uPVC doors are resistant to rot, rust, and corrosion, guaranteeing a long life expectancy with very little upkeep.

  • Energy Efficiency: Their style provides much better insulation, which assists in maintaining indoor temperature levels, decreasing heating and cooling costs.

  • Low Maintenance: Unlike wood or metal frames, uPVC needs only periodic cleaning to look brand new. It is exempt to peeling, flaking, or fading.

  • Visual Variety: uPVC doors come in numerous designs and colors, enabling property owners to create custom looks that match their home's exterior and interior.

  • Security Features: Most modern uPVC doors feature multi-point locking systems that boost home security.

Advantages of uPVC Doors with Windows

The integration of windows into the uPVC door style offers a number of distinct advantages:

  1. Natural Light: Windows allow natural light to permeate living spaces, making them brighter and more inviting.
  2. Ventilation: Opening windows can enhance airflow, which is especially useful in warmer environments.
  3. Sound Insulation: Many uPVC doors with windows are built with double or triple glazing, substantially lowering external sound.
  4. Enhanced Views: With bigger window panels, homeowners can enjoy unobstructed views of their environments.

Styles of uPVC Doors with Windows

There are a number of styles of uPVC doors available that incorporate windows. Each design serves different aesthetic and functional requirements:

  • French Doors: Typically opening external and including glass panes throughout the door, French doors produce a classy and open feel, perfect for patios or garden access.

  • Bi-Folding Doors: These doors include multiple panels that fold to the side, optimizing space and flawlessly blending indoor and outdoor locations.

  • Sliding Doors: Sliding uPVC doors are excellent for compact spaces, supplying a smooth shift in between the exterior and interior without sacrificing style.

  • Stable Doors: Often characterized by a split style, steady doors enable adjustable gain access to, making them ideal for cooking areas or utility locations.

Considerations When Choosing uPVC Doors with Windows

When choosing uPVC doors with windows, homeowners ought to consider a number of factors:

  • Design Compatibility: Ensure the door design harmonizes with the home's total design and architecture.

  • Glazing Options: Double or triple glazing can enhance thermal insulation and noise reduction.

  • Security Ratings: Look for uPVC doors with high security scores to guarantee security.

  • Energy Ratings: Check for energy-efficiency labels to understand the door's performance worrying insulation.

  • Budget plan: Costs can differ commonly based on style, size, and features, so developing a spending plan is important.

FAQs about uPVC Doors with Windows

1. For how long do uPVC doors last?

uPVC doors can last anywhere from 20 to 35 years, depending on maintenance and direct exposure to the elements.

2. Are uPVC doors energy-efficient?

Yes, uPVC doors use exceptional insulation, adding to energy effectiveness by minimizing heat loss or gain.

3. Can I paint uPVC doors?

While it's possible to paint uPVC doors, it's usually not recommended as they need particular paint types. It is better to select a color that fits your aesthetic requirements from the start.

4. How do I clean uPVC windows and doors?

You can clean up uPVC windows and doors with soapy water and a soft cloth. Avoid abrasive cleaners that may scratch the surface area.

5. Are uPVC doors environmentally friendly?

uPVC is a recyclable material, making it a more sustainable option than some other materials when disposed of properly.
